Output 0e388630a2cb7f7435bdc757b96a79eeab136b42c785d52a0fc028dc07f8677f:1

value
148121559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8e142c083d18a3f8ba1580c623d6c56c9f48e4e OP_EQUAL
address
3JYa7EQCevyzM4TZAkriccmyjqQz2Wfes4
transaction
0e388630a2cb7f7435bdc757b96a79eeab136b42c785d52a0fc028dc07f8677f
confirmations
294128
spent
true